wsdydmw 2011-08-23 21:40
浏览 377
已采纳

请问用cleditor内容如何赋值啊

[size=large]请问下用cleditor 我用的$('#field_content').val("所要显示的值");显示不出来 field_content是这个编辑器的id [/size]

  • 写回答

11条回答 默认 最新

  • myali88 2011-08-29 11:11
    关注

    确实,我下载下来也没看看,但是我上次下载,自己电脑上是有的。不管怎么样,就用现在下载的这个也可以做到:
    [code="java"]
    $(document).ready(function() {
    var o = $("#input").cleditor()[0];//关键是这里获取第一个对象,否则upateFrame无法调用
    $('#input').html('

    aaaaa

    ');
    o.updateFrame();
    });
    [/code]
    HTML:
    [code="java"]

    sssssssssssssssssssss

    [/code]
    关键的地方上面已经说明了,我也测试过,可以的。可能是.cleditor()方法不像其他的jquery插件那样,内部使用迭代,导致返回直接就是一个数组,所以调用不了upateFrame.
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(10条)

报告相同问题?